
The schedule for the six matches Nepal will play in the NT Top End T20 Series, hosted in Australia, has been released. Nepal is set to begin the tournament against NT Strike on October 5. The Cricket Association of Nepal has yet to announce its squad for the competition.
According to the match schedule for the NT Top End T20 Series, held in Australia’s Northern Territory, Nepal will play six league-stage matches in Darwin from October 5 to October 14. Nepal’s opening game will be against NT Strike on October 5. The team will then face Bangladesh High Performance on October 6, Hobart Hurricanes Academy on October 8, ACT Comets on October 10, Kingsmen on October 11, and Victoria on October 13.
In the previous edition, Nepal won two of their six matches while losing four. The Cricket Association of Nepal (CAN) has not yet named the squad for this edition. With the possibility of the ACC Premier Cup also being hosted there, Nepal may announce two separate squads for the events.
